欢迎光临朱凯的个人博客!
朱凯,a3.work

ios中URL编码

 发布时间: 2017-12-23 18:50      原创:  朱凯博客      评论: .       .人查看

开发中,有时会出现给参数或者整个url做一个 URLEncoded编码 编码的需求

代码如下:

- (NSString *)KURLEncodedString{
  NSString *charactersToEscape = @"?!@#$^&%*+,:;='\"`<>()[]{}/\\| ";
  NSCharacterSet *allowedCharacters = [[NSCharacterSet characterSetWithCharactersInString:charactersToEscape] invertedSet];
  NSString *encodedUrl = [self stringByAddingPercentEncodingWithAllowedCharacters:allowedCharacters];
  return encodedUrl;
}

我这个是在 NSString 分类中实现的,你也可以封装在方法中

转载请注明来源:   ios中URL编码  - 朱凯博客

分享是一种快乐,也是一种美德:
¥打开支付宝,扫码领红包¥ 红包

支付宝 aliPay

微信 wxPay